I knelt to pray

I knelt to pray but not for long
I had to much to do
Must hurry off and get to work
For bills would soon be due
And so I said a hurried prayer
Jumped up from off my knees
My christian duties now were done
My soul could be at ease
All through the day I had no time
To speak a word of cheer
No time to speak of christ to friends
They would laugh at me I feared
No time not time to much to do
That was my constant cry
No time to give to those in need
At last was time to die
And when before the lord I came
I stood with downcast eyes
Within his hands he held a book
It was the book of life
God looked into his book and said
Your name I can not find
I once was going to write it down
But never found the time
